NXP (founded by Philips) LPC2109/01

The NXP (founded by Philips) LPC2109/01 is an ARM7TDMI-S based high-performance 32-bit RISC Microcontroller with Thumb extensions 64KB on-chip Flash ROM with In-System Programming (ISP) and In-Application Programming (IAP) 8KB RAM, Vectored Interrupt Controller, Two UARTs, I2C serial interface, 2 SPI serial interfaces, Two timers (7 capture/compare channels), PWM unit with up to 6 PWM outputs, 4-channels 10bit ADC, 1 CAN channel. Real Time Clock, Watchdog Timer, General purpose I/O pins. CPU clock up to 60 MHz, On-chip crystal oscillator and On-chip PLL.
